
The five-person cast of “A Day In The Life” takes the audience on a journey back to the turbulent decade of the 1960s. A collage of media depicting the highs and lows of the counterculture movement during the era of free love, peace, and hippies accompanies the live onstage performance by the show’s cast. The Beatles’ entire career, from Ed Sullivan to Abbey Road, is recreated through five costume changes. Hear classics like “I Want To Hold Your Hand,” “Yesterday,” “Come Together,” “Let It Be” and “A Day In The Life.”
The show features Morgan Cates (bass), Ira Kramer (rhythm guitar), Josh Kovach (lead guitar), Andrew Carlson (drums) and Colin Graebert (keyboards). “A Day In The Life” is the only complete Beatles retrospective on the east coast performed with Beatles-aged performers.
